Floyd Lahache (Born September 17, 1957, in Caughnawaga, Quebec) is a retired hockey defenceman. He was drafted 114th overall by the Chicago Blackhawks in the 1977 NHL Amateur Draft and 25th overall by the Cincinnati Stingers. He went on to play 11 games in the World Hockey Association with the Stingers in 1977-78, scoring 3 assists.
